      Costco Increases Quarterly Dividend by 13%

      Costco has announced a 13% increase in its quarterly dividend, reflecting the company's commitment to returning value to its shareholders. This adjustment comes as part of Costco's ongoing strategy to reward investors amid a competitive retail landscape.

      Research from Vanguard indicates that approximately half of investors favor dividend-paying companies, as they tend to offer higher returns and reduced volatility compared to non-dividend stocks. Many investors express a preference for companies that provide substantial dividends, viewing them as a sign of financial health and stability.

      The increase in Costco's dividend aligns with these investor preferences, potentially attracting more interest from those seeking reliable income from their investments. As Costco continues to grow, its ability to enhance shareholder returns through dividends may further solidify its position in the market.
